B. Schade Brewing Co. v. Falls City Pickle Works

Citations

  • 55 Wash. 202
  • 104 P. 175
  • 1909 Wash. LEXIS 732

Syllabus

<p>Waters and Water Courses — Drains—Severance of Ownership— Covenants — Dominant and Servient Estates. Where the owner, for his own convenience, constructed a drain across two lots to an outlet, and afterwards conveyed the dominant and servient estates to different parties by warranty deed, no obligation rests upon the grantee of the dominant estate to remove or close the drain, but the burden thereof rests upon the grantee of the servient estate.</p>
